Senior Director Endpoint Management and Executive Success

Job Description

  • Job code: 010564
  • Pay grade: I
  • Pay type: Exempt/salaried

General summary

Provides leadership for the development and implementation of organization wide endpoint management strategies for all institution owned devices. Coordinates onboarding and alignment of technology units to ensure a consistent, scalable, and comprehensive approach that supports institutional goals. Leads the development, maintenance, and oversight of technology assets across multiple administrative units to ensure lifecycle management, operational efficiency, and strategic alignment.

Major duties

  • Strategizes and leads the development of centralized imaging and application deployment processes to support scalability and accessibility across the University.
  • Manages organization hardware and software lifecycle, budgeting, and procurement.
  • Develops and enforces comprehensive IT policies and procedures that reflect University standards and align with industry best practices. Fosters a consistent, secure and efficient technology environment.
  • Leads the development and administration of configuration management systems for the standardization of end-user devices.
  • Leads collaboration with the security to design, implement, and maintain institutional information security controls on end user devices, ensuring alignment with regulatory requirements and university-wide risk management strategies.
  • Represents supported departments in ongoing information technology strategies and committees to align departmental resources with institutional goals.
  • Oversees and monitors the compliance and patching of university-owned devices, ensuring adherence to security policies.
  • Hires, trains, supervises and evaluates performance of information technology staff.

Minimum qualifications

Minimum qualifications based upon job documentation and industry best practices. Any current employees not meeting these qualifications will be grandfathered until they move to a different job.

Required education

  • Bachelor's degree in related field from an accredited institution.

Required experience

  • Five years' relevant experience.
  • Supervisory experience.
  • Experience providing service to Senior Leadership and Administrators.
  • Experience managing and directing external vendor relationships.

Required other

  • Ability to work irregular shifts and extended hours, including weekends, holidays and on call duty.

Physical requirements

Light work with some physical demands such as continuously lifting or moving materials less than 25 pounds, but rarely moving more than 25 to 50 pounds.

Working conditions

Work is generally performed in a well-lit, temperature-controlled indoor environment with occasional exposure to the outdoors or any number of elements.
